Overview of the issue
After updating to WordPress 6.7, users report that some WooCommerce Germanized Pro strings appear in English instead of the site’s default language (German). The issue affects both backend and frontend translations.
The problem persists partially even after updating WPML String Translation to version 3.2.16, which resolved related issues for other plugins.
Workaround
Our development team is working on this issue as it indicates an edge case specific to WooCommerce Germanized.
In the meantime, temporarily revert to WordPress 6.6.2 while awaiting a complete fix.
